Is North Aurora or San Diego Safer?
According to crimebycity.com's analysis of 2024 FBI data, North Aurora is safer than San Diego (Safety Score 74/100 vs 38/100), with a total crime rate of 1,012 per 100,000 versus 2,082 for San Diego — 51% lower. North Aurora has lower rates in 7 of 7 crime categories.
The biggest difference is in murder, where North Aurora has a 100% lower rate.
Note: San Diego is 72.1x larger by coverage, which can affect crime rate comparisons. Larger cities tend to report higher rates due to density and more comprehensive reporting.

Detailed Crime Rate Comparison
| Crime Type | North Aurora | San Diego |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Crime Rate | 1,011.6 | 2,082.4 | -1,070.8 |
| Violent Crime Rate | 140.1 | 412.4 | -272.3 |
| Murder Rate | 0.0 | 2.5 | -2.5 |
| Rape Rate | 93.4 | 21.4 | +72.0 |
| Robbery Rate | 10.4 | 77.4 | -67.0 |
| Aggravated Assault Rate | 31.1 | 310.9 | -279.8 |
| Property Crime Rate | 871.6 | 1,670.0 | -798.5 |
| Burglary Rate | 83.0 | 187.4 | -104.4 |
| Larceny-Theft Rate | 715.9 | 1,087.1 | -371.2 |
| Motor Vehicle Theft Rate | 72.6 | 395.5 | -322.9 |
All rates per 100,000 residents. Source: FBI UCR 2024.

About North Aurora, IL
North Aurora, a Fox River community, grew significantly after the Chicago Aurora and Elgin Railroad arrived. This village of around 18,000 residents spans both sides of the river, primarily in Kane County. With a safety score of 74/100 and a population coverage of 19,276, North Aurora has a total crime rate of 1,011.6 per 100,000 residents.
About San Diego, CA
San Diego, California, a major port city with a significant Hispanic population, sits on the Pacific Ocean just north of the Mexican border. Known for its mild climate and Balboa Park, it's also home to a large naval presence. With a safety score of 38/100 and a population coverage of 1,389,024, San Diego has a total crime rate of 2,082.4 per 100,000 residents.
